About the Role
BetMGM is currently seeking a Senior Compensation Analyst who will provide subject matter expertise and compensation consulting to People Partners and Business leaders, as well as maintain oversight and ownership of our existing compensation programs across a diverse and growing business. The Senior Compensation Analyst will have the opportunity to grow and shape future compensation strategy while supporting our overall Total Rewards strategy.

Responsibilities
  • Own the process of job analysis, including holistic job evaluation, level analysis, FLSA classification, and market pricing for new positions throughout the company
  • Develop strong partnerships and provide consultation and support to assigned Departments as well as People Business Partners for Compensation decisions and advice
  • Participate in salary survey submission process; analyze survey data and provide recommendations to remain market competitive.
  • Own project planning for year-end programs, including but not limited to merit cycle, short-term incentive planning, and/or LTIP grants and payouts
  • Assist in the execution of the company's annual compensation processes
  • Act as the point of contact for ongoing quarterly compensation incentive programs
  • Manage BetMGM's LTIP program, including grant creation and issuing, maintenance of participant lists, and liaising with our Finance and Payroll teams to coordinate payouts
  • Act as a subject-matter expert in Compensation, cross-functionally aiding the business and suggesting process improvements
  • Complete ad-hoc compensation requests and analyses from People Business Partners and Business leaders
  • Maintain a high level of accuracy, accountability, and integrity in data reporting
  • Process compensation-related transactions, from job and compensation grade creation to approving job and compensation change requests in Workday
  • Participate and own ad-hoc people related projects as needed

Licensing Requirements
As an online gaming company, BetMGM is required to comply with state gaming regulations which includes licensing obligations. Applicable employees must be licensed by at least one jurisdictional agency, although certain positions require licensing by multiple agencies. Failure to become licensed or maintain licensure with each agency as required for the role may result in termination of employment. Please note that the licensing process includes comprehensive background checks which may include a review of criminal records, financial history, and personal background verification.
